The Department of Municipal and Northern Relations is seeking highly motivated individuals to fill Assessment Officer positions, located in Minnedosa, Manitoba.
Are you looking for a career that combines the outdoors, working with people, travel to Manitoba communities and in-office work? Why not explore a career as an Assessment Officer? If you have a background or interest in building construction, agribusiness, agronomy, mortage lending, property assessment administration, building inspection, real estate or real estate appraisal we encourage you to consider this new career opportunity. Assessment Officers are provided on-the-job training and financial assistance to complete requied education.
Government of Manitoba employee are eligible for Learning and Development Programs and access to a comprehensive Benefit Package which includes: paid vacation, extended health, health spending, dental, drug, vision, long term disability; Supportive Employment Program, maternity and parental leave, and a defined Retirement and Pension Plan (some pension plans allow for portability between the Civil Service Superannuation Board and employers).
Please note, Assessment Officers will be hired at the Assessment Officer 2 (AS2) level ($52,314 - $63,378) unless the incumbent completed a Certificate in Real Property Assessment, IAAO designation or equivalent and have experience valuing and/or inspecting a wide range of residential, farm, and/or small to medium sized commercial buildings. Upon successful certification, incumbents are eligible for appointment to the AS3 Classification.
